The Rehm-Bohlman Tract contains
approximately 186 acres and is former
Plum Creek land in McCurtain County,
Oklahoma. This is an excellent
recreational and timber investment
tract with two ages of industrial quality
pine plantations plus two hardwood
areas for hunting. Immediate income
potential is available on the 1986 plantation.
The flooded hardwood holds
waterfowl year-round. Access is excellent
with 1/2 mile of paved frontage
and internal gravel roads that are accessible
year-round and have been
recently upgraded with new culverts.
